Beyond the Wrist: Defining the Modern Wearable Ecosystem

When we think of wearables, the first image is often a smartwatch or a fitness band. However, the category has exploded into a diverse array of form factors, each with its own specialized ecosystem of add-ons. Wearable tech accessories are no longer just about protection; they are about augmentation. They are the critical components that enhance functionality, personalize aesthetics, and extend the capabilities of the primary device.

This ecosystem can be broadly categorized into several key areas:

  • Functional Augmentation: These accessories add new hardware capabilities, such as external sensors, additional battery packs, or specialized mounts.
  • Personalization and Aesthetics: This includes bands, cases, and skins that allow users to express their style and make a mass-produced device feel uniquely their own.
  • Specialized Use Cases: Accessories designed for specific activities, like ruggedized cases for extreme sports, clip-on modules for athletes, or elegant chargers that double as jewelry stands.
  • Connectivity and Integration: Items that enable the wearable to interact with other devices or environments, such as smart tags or wireless charging pucks.

The Engine of Enhancement: How Accessories Amplify Core Functionality

The most impactful accessories are those that fundamentally change what the parent device can do. They act as a platform for expansion, a concept that was once the domain of desktop computers. A prime example is the rise of external sensor modules. A standard wearable might track heart rate and movement, but a clip-on air quality sensor can turn it into an environmental health monitor, providing data on pollen count or pollution levels in real-time. Similarly, a wearable blood glucose monitor attached to a smartwatch can transform it into a life-saving management tool for individuals with diabetes, seamlessly streaming data without the need for constant phone checks.

Battery life remains one of the most significant constraints in wearable design. Innovative accessory makers have tackled this head-on with products like battery-extending bands or compact, portable charging cases. These solutions empower users to embark on multi-day adventures or simply get through a heavy-use day without the anxiety of a dying device. This is not merely a convenience; for devices focused on health monitoring, consistent power is synonymous with consistent data collection, which can be critically important.

A Statement on Your Sleeve: The Fashion of Technology

For technology to be truly wearable, it must be not just functional but also desirable. It must conform to the user's identity and aesthetic, not the other way around. This is where the fashion and materials revolution in accessories plays a pivotal role. The standard silicone band that comes in the box is often just the starting point.

The market now offers an incredible array of materials:

  • Luxury Materials: Bands crafted from titanium, ceramic, tungsten, and even precious metals like gold and platinum cater to a high-end market, blurring the line between fine jewelry and advanced technology.
  • Artisanal and Niche: Hand-stitched leather bands, woven fabrics from sustainable sources, and collaborations with famous fashion designers have given wearables a bespoke feel.
  • Novelty and Expression: From bands featuring popular franchise characters to those with integrated patterns or lights, accessories allow for mood-based and personality-driven expression.

This shift is crucial for mass adoption. It allows a single technological device to be appropriate in a boardroom, a gym, and a formal gala, simply by changing its external accessory. The device remains constant, but its identity is fluid and user-defined.

Tailoring the Experience: Accessories for Specialized Lifestyles

Beyond fashion and basic function, a thriving segment of the accessory market caters to highly specific user needs and activities. These products solve distinct problems for niche audiences, demonstrating the versatility of the wearable platform.

  • The Athlete: For runners, swimmers, and cyclists, accessories include durable, non-chafing bands, satellite communication pucks for off-grid safety, and mounts that attach devices to equipment like bike handlebars or swimming goggles.
  • The Adventurer: This group needs ruggedized, shockproof cases that can withstand extreme conditions, extended battery packs for multi-day excursions, and solar-powered chargers for ultimate off-grid capability.
  • The Professional: In healthcare settings, hypoallergenic bands and easy-to-clean cases are essential. In industrial environments, accessories might include built-in RFID badges for access control or enhanced displays for reading data in bright sunlight.
  • The Parent and Child: Wearables for children often focus on safety and durability. Accessories include colorful, fun bands that are easy for small hands to manage, and cases designed to withstand the inevitable drops and scrapes of childhood.

The Seamless Integration: Chargers, Docks, and the Invisible Infrastructure

Some of the most important accessories are those that manage the device's downtime. Charging is a fundamental requirement, and the humble charger has evolved into a key part of the user experience. Modern charging accessories focus on convenience, speed, and reducing clutter.

Wireless charging stands have become popular, often doubling as a nightstand clock or a stylish display piece. Multi-device docking stations that can charge a wearable, a smartphone, and wireless earbuds simultaneously are solving the modern problem of "cable fatigue." There is also a growing trend towards integrating charging solutions into furniture itself—lamps with built-in charging pads or bedside tables with integrated wireless charging coils. This represents the ultimate goal: making the maintenance of our technology as effortless and invisible as its use.

Navigating the Market: Considerations for the Conscious Consumer

With a booming market comes the challenge of choice. Selecting the right wearable tech accessory requires careful consideration beyond mere aesthetics.

  • Compatibility: This is the foremost concern. Not all bands use the same lug attachment system, and not all chargers use the same standard (e.g., Qi wireless vs. proprietary magnetic). Ensuring a perfect fit and functional match is essential.
  • Quality and Safety: Especially with critical items like chargers and batteries, opting for reputable manufacturers who adhere to safety standards is non-negotiable. A cheap, uncertified charger can pose a fire hazard and potentially damage expensive devices.
  • Material and Craftsmanship: For items worn against the skin, like bands, material matters. Hypoallergenic materials like medical-grade silicone, certain metals, and high-quality leather are important for comfort and preventing irritation.
  • Intended Use: Matching the accessory to the activity is key. A leather band is unsuitable for swimming, just as a bulky rugged case is unnecessary for everyday office wear.

Gazing into the Crystal Ball: The Future of Wearable Tech Accessories

The future of this industry is tied to the evolution of the wearables themselves. As devices become more advanced, smaller, and more integrated, so too will their accessories. We can anticipate several exciting trends:

  • Modularity: The concept of a core device that can be physically augmented with different accessory modules (e.g., a better camera, a specific medical sensor, an extended battery) could become mainstream, allowing users to customize their device's hardware for their needs.
  • Biometric Integration: Accessories themselves will become smarter. We might see bands with their own embedded sensors for more accurate readings or materials that can analyze sweat composition.
  • Sustainability: The push for eco-friendly products will grow stronger. Expect to see more accessories made from recycled materials, ocean plastics, and biodegradable components, alongside brands offering robust recycling programs for old accessories.
  • Advanced Materials Science: The development of new, flexible, and durable materials will lead to accessories that are currently unimaginable—think self-healing bands, color-changing skins, or textiles that can harvest energy from movement or sunlight.
